Directed by Gabriele Muccino, Seven Pounds follows (Will Smith), a man haunted by a tragic secret. Posing as an IRS agent, Ben meticulously selects seven strangers whose lives he intends to transform. His mission is rooted in a past event where he caused a car accident that killed seven people, including his fiancée.
His clinical, calculated plan faces an unexpected challenge when he meets Emily Posa (Rosario Dawson), a vibrant young woman suffering from terminal heart failure.
